Transaction 32abf72707f3886ce4e6d39c863cc3b2e12cae1e86bc2d9c18439cfc00041ac7

3 Input
1 Outputs
  • 32abf72707f3886ce4e6d39c863cc3b2e12cae1e86bc2d9c18439cfc00041ac7:0
  • value  5766200
    address  32ggFEfoWDsF8QiEvo4zfLUjJeAqirVDhd